When do the Capital Region’s mini-golf courses open?

ALBANY, N.Y. (NEWS10) -- With the warm weather quickly approaching, some mini-golf courses in the area have already opened for the season. While some courses have announced an opening date, others have not.
Here’s when and where you can go play mini-golf in the Capital Region. For those that have not yet announced an opening date, you can check back here periodically for updates.
Open
- Pirate’s Hideout, 175 Guideboard Road in Halfmoon
- Opened March 14
- The Fun Spot, 1035 Route 9 in Queensbury
- Adventure golf opened on March 29
- FunPlex Fun Park, 589 Columbia Turnpike in East Greenbush
- Opened on April 1
- The Wind-Chill Factory & Mini-Golf, 3 Trieble Avenue in Milton
- Opened April 8
Opening soon
- Hillbilly Fun Park, 10375 Route 149 in Fort Ann
- Opening on April 26
- Pirate’s Cove Adventure Golf, 1089 Route 9 in Queensbury, and 2115 Route 9 in Lake George
- Opening the last weekend of April
- Around the World Miniature Golf, 72 Beach Road in Lake George
- Opening the second weekend of May
- All 4 Fun, 1050 Troy Schenectady Road in Latham
- Opening early-to mid-May
- Grandview Mini Golf, 291 Houseman Street in Mayfield
- Opening early-to-mid May
- Olde Saratoga Miniature Golf, 556 Maple Avenue in Saratoga Springs
- Opening May 18
Based on previous year
- Gobbler’s Knob Family Fun Park, 3793 Route 145 in Cobleskill
- No set opening date yet, last year opened on May 12
- Players Park, 1012 Ballston Lake Road in Clifton Park
- Last year opened on May 6
- Goony Golf, 2059 Route 9 in Lake George
- Last year opened on April 13
- Lumberjack Pass Miniature Golf, 1511 Route 9 in Lake George
- Opened in June last year
- Dan’s Miniature Golf, 14 Round Lake Road in Ballston Lake
- Last year opened on May 14
